Big Peat 2019 Christmas Edition is a collectable Scotch whisky from Big Peat, bottled in 2019. Based on 23 recorded auction lots across 14 months of trading data, the current median hammer price is £44, with the most recent sale at £35. Over the trading window, prices have ranged from £35 (low) to £70 (high). Accounting for lot-to-lot variation, a realistic valuation range for Big Peat 2019 Christmas Edition is £32–£38 8% around the latest sale).

Year-on-year, Big Peat 2019 Christmas Edition is down 39.1%, with a 6-month trend of -22.2% (down). wsky1 aggregates hammer prices from major public Scotch whisky auctions including Scotch Whisky Auctions, Whisky Auctioneer, and Bonhams. All prices are in GBP and exclude buyer's premium (typically 24–28% additional at major houses). Past auction performance is not a guarantee of future value.

Where can I sell Big Peat 2019 Christmas Edition?

Big Peat 2019 Christmas Edition regularly appears at major Scotch whisky auction houses including Scotch Whisky Auctions (Scotland), Whisky Auctioneer (Scotland), Just Whisky, Whisky Hammer, and Bonhams. The current median hammer price is £44 (excluding buyer's premium). At most major houses, buyer's premium adds 24–28% on top of hammer for the buyer; sellers typically receive the hammer price minus a sales commission of 5–15%.

How does wsky1 calculate the price of Big Peat 2019 Christmas Edition?

wsky1 ingests public auction results from major auction houses (via direct scraping of Scotch Whisky Auctions, Whisky Auctioneer, Bonhams, and Whisky Hammer, plus aggregated data from WhiskyHunter). For each bottle, we group hammer prices by year-month and compute the median price per month. The figures shown — latest £35, 24-month median £44 — are derived from this monthly-median methodology. All prices are hammer prices in GBP, excluding buyer's premium.

Does the price include buyer's premium?

No. All prices on wsky1 are hammer prices only. Buyer's premium at major Scotch whisky auction houses currently runs at 24–28% on top of the hammer price. A bottle of Big Peat 2019 Christmas Edition that hammers at £35 would cost the buyer approximately £44 all-in including buyer's premium.
